The star Proxima Centauri and its neighboring duo of Alpha Centauri A and B are the closest stars to the sun, lying a mere 4.2 light-years away. Proxima, the nearest of the trio, is a dim red orb with frequent, powerful flares that buffet the Earth-mass planet that orbits close to it.
